Jade Fabello is an Austin-based freelance writer and editor and the operations manager for the AfroRithm Futures Group. A former political public speaker for senate candidates, Jade now primarily writes personal essays about politics, race, art, grief, and love. He has written for Texas Monthly, Austin Monthly, Study Hall, Fero’s Magazine, the Brown Journal of Philosophy, Politics, and Economics, Batshit Times, and more. He is an experienced magazine editor and writing workshop leader, serving as the senior print editor for the Austin fashion publication Spark Magazine. He is also the writer of “I love words and you.” a newsletter that covers the craft of writing. He is known for his debut freelancing piece: “What I Learned as a Young Black Political Speaker in Liberal White Austin.” Jade has interviewed Narcos actor Juan Riedinger, Chilling Adventures of Sabrina actress Tati Gabrielle, and Austin’s first Black glam rockstar Bevis Griffin.
